Thrust ball bearings, which are designed to handle axial loads, are a key component in mechanical equipment. They are widely used in heavy machinery, automobiles, aerospace, and other industrial fields, providing stable support and efficient movement.

Application Areas of Machine Tool Bearings
1.CNC Machinery:
Machine tool bearings used in CNC (Computer Numerical Control)
machines for precise movement and positioning of the cutting tools
and workpieces.
2.Lathes:
Machine tool bearings Essential in turning operations to smoothly
rotate the workpiece and ensure accurate machining.
3.Milling Machines:
Found in milling machines where they support the spindle and
facilitate the rotation of cutting tools.
4.Drilling Machines:
Machine tool bearings Used in various drilling applications to
maintain alignment and support high-speed rotation.
5.Grinding Machines:
Machine tool bearings Critical for the precision movement of
grinding wheels for fine surface finishing.
6.Robotics:
Incorporated in robotic arms and automation equipment for smooth
motion control and precise articulation.
7.Textile Machines:
Machine tool bearings Employed in machines for weaving, knitting,
and dyeing to support rotating components and reduce friction.
8.Packaging Machinery:
Machine tool bearings Used in packing lines and machines to
optimize the movement of packaging materials and containers.
9.Food Processing Machinery:
Machine tool bearings Applied in food packaging, processing, and
handling equipment where hygiene and reliability are critical.
10.Industrial Equipment:
Machine tool bearings found in various industrial machinery,
including conveyors, presses, and stamping machines, ensuring
smooth operation under load.
11.Print and Paper Industries:
Machine tool bearings facilitates the precise operation of printing
presses and paper handling machines, ensuring quality print output.
12.Aerospace and Defense:
Machine tool bearings applied in specialized machines for
manufacturing aerospace components, providing reliability under
critical conditions.
13.Automotive Machinery:
Utilized in manufacturing equipment for automotive parts, including
assembly lines and machining centers.
14.Woodworking Machinery:
Machine tool bearings Used in saws, routers, and other woodworking
tools for accurate cutting and shaping of materials.
15.Mining and Oil & Gas:
Machine tool bearings applied in heavy machinery and drilling
equipment to optimize performance in harsh environments.
